About The Position

This position provides high level support to the payroll team, including ensuring payroll, partner draws and distributions, and special pay arrangements are completed in a timely and accurate manner. The incumbent will be responsible for knowing in detail all aspects of partner, non-partner attorney and staff payroll and will be responsible for processing one (or more) of the payroll cycles semi-monthly, as assigned. The incumbent will support maintenance of the profit-sharing plan and cash balance plan and will also provide support for the annual attorney compensation review process, annual audit, and annual 5500 audit(s).

Responsibilities

  • Semi-Monthly/Monthly Payroll Processing & Administration (45%): As assigned/requested by Senior Payroll Manager: Processing of semi-monthly partner draws, and non-partner attorney (NPA) and staff payrolls; Posting of semi-monthly NPA and staff payrolls to general ledger; Posting of semi-monthly draw and periodic distributions to general ledger; Providing guidance to other team members on reconciling payroll records; research and analyze any issues identified and resolve as necessary. Act as a subject matter expert and/or resource to others in the areas of payroll processing and payroll law. Understand and keep abreast of the current tax requirements, including state, federal and local taxes, complete monthly and quarterly tax reconciliations. Ensure ongoing compliance with federal, state, and local payroll regulations, including monitoring regulatory updates and advising the team when changes are required. Assist with ongoing setup, review and maintenance of the HRIS and timekeeping systems; provide back-up support during other team member absences. Create and maintain standard operating procedures/checklists and ensure that policies and procedures are adhered to. Responsible for maintenance and implementation of special compensation payment arrangements with partners and other attorneys. Supports other payroll team members in processing of assigned payroll cycles, maintenance of time and attendance system, and payments to vendors. Ensures all are completed in an accurate, timely, and efficient manner. Works with payroll team, payroll provider, and Human Resources to identify and implement process and system improvements to payroll processing. Partner with HR, Benefits, Finance, and outside vendors to ensure accurate processing of compensation adjustments, benefit deductions, retirement plan contributions, and year-end reporting.
  • Retirement & Cash Balance Plans (20%) Responsible for monitoring Vanguard My Plan Manager daily. Work with Plan Administrator to process non-routine requests. Work with Vanguard to research and correct any payroll discrepancies, loan discrepancies, or plan discrepancies. Answer questions plan participants have regarding the Firm's profit-sharing plan. Requires detailed knowledge of Firm's profit-sharing plan's provisions, Vanguard system, and payroll system (including how all interact with one another). Answer questions plan participants have regarding the Firm's cash balance plan - requires detailed knowledge of cash balance plan platform, plan provisions, and regulations.
  • Annually/Quarterly (20%) Support and provide data for annual corporate audits. Support and provide data for annual ERISA audit. Support annual worker compensation audit. Manage quarterly tax report reviews and resolve discrepancies. Oversee reconciliation of payroll reports to general ledger accounts.
  • Reporting, Systems, & Internal Controls (10%) Possess detailed knowledge of reporting capabilities of payroll system, identifying relevant reports; develop and implement processes and procedures for processing and balancing; Produce appropriate data for audits (e.g., workers' compensation, year-end audit and ERISA audit). Support system updates, testing, and enhancements; identify and recommend process improvements to increase accuracy, efficiency, and automation. Maintain strong internal controls and data integrity across payroll systems.
  • General and Administrative (5%) Provide guidance and training to team members and serve as a backup to the Senior Payroll Manager as needed. Performs other duties as assigned.
